Sæból remote farm, Westfjords

Sæból is a historic farm in one of the most remote parts of Iceland. Visitors will find a truly authentic experience of life in the Westfjords, past and present. It provides amazing access to the mountains and the sea, and the opportunity to enjoy the remoteness and quiet that make the Westfjords so special. In Sæból lives a friendly sheep farmer known as Bettý (my mother) and she is the last remaining resident of Ingjaldssandur. She also makes beautiful handcrafts that she sells at her house.
